Victorinox Swiss Army Outdoor Master FAQ
The Swiss Army Outdoor Master Mic series marks Victorinox's expansion into dedicated fixed blades, offering bushcraft-focused designs manufactured by Muela in Spain. These knives feature durable canvas Micarta handles and Scandi grinds, making them highly capable tools for camping, hiking, and woodcraft.
What kind of steel is used in the Outdoor Master series?
The Swiss Army Outdoor Master Mic series uses German 4116 stainless steel, which is highly resistant to corrosion and stains. While it does not offer the highest edge retention, it is exceptionally easy to sharpen and touch up in the field, which is essential for a dedicated outdoor tool.
What is unique about the grind on these fixed blades?
These knives feature a Scandi grind with a subtle convex micro-bevel at the edge. This specific geometry increases the durability of the blade and makes it easier to maintain than a traditional zero-grind Scandi while remaining an excellent choice for carving and wood processing.
How do the Large and Small Outdoor Master models differ?
The Large model features a 4-inch blade with a 5/32 inch thickness and includes a specialized Kydex sheath with a fire starter and drop-leg system. The Small model has a 2.75-inch blade at 1/8 inch thickness, making it ideal for whittling, EDC tasks, or neck carry using the included paracord.
What are the handle materials on the Outdoor Master Mic?
The handles are made from blue and black layered canvas Micarta with distinctive red liners. This material provides a secure, contoured grip that fits the hand well for extended use, and the exposed extended tang at the pommel can be used for light hammering or thumping tasks.
Where are these Victorinox fixed blades manufactured?
The Swiss Army Outdoor Master Mic series is manufactured for Victorinox by Muela in Spain. This partnership allows Victorinox to offer a specialized Swiss Army fixed blade built to the specific requirements of bushcraft and outdoor survival.
Does the sheath include any safety features?
Yes, the Large model's Kydex sheath features a slide lock system that secures the knife in place, preventing it from being accidentally pulled out. The sheath also includes a drain hole to manage moisture and a dedicated loop for the included fire steel.
